If you’re considering a move to Davis, CA, the Grande neighborhood in the southeast part of the city offers a welcoming and vibrant community perfect for families, professionals, and students alike. Known for its well-maintained homes and friendly atmosphere, Grande provides residents with a peaceful suburban feel while still being close to the city's amenities. One of the standout features of this neighborhood is its proximity to the beautiful Davis Arboretum, a serene spot perfect for leisurely walks, bird watching, and enjoying nature without venturing far from home. Additionally, Grande benefits from several parks and green spaces, making it a great choice for those who appreciate outdoor activities and a healthy lifestyle.

For those new to Davis or relocating, the Grande area boasts convenient access to everyday necessities. Local shopping centers, grocery stores, and cafes are scattered throughout the neighborhood, offering plenty of options for dining and errands without having to travel far. Families will appreciate the quality schools nearby, renowned for their strong academic programs and community involvement. Plus, the neighborhood is bike-friendly, a big plus in Davis, where cycling is a popular mode of transportation. Whether you’re commuting to work or heading out for a weekend adventure, Grande’s connectivity ensures you can easily reach Downtown Davis, which is just a short drive or bike ride to the northwest, where you’ll find a lively mix of shops, restaurants, and cultural events.

Frequently Asked Questions

What is the overall lifestyle like?

Grande in Davis, CA offers a balanced lifestyle that combines suburban tranquility with easy access to urban amenities. Residents enjoy a family-friendly environment with plenty of green spaces, bike paths, and parks such as the nearby Sutter Davis Hospital Park. The neighborhood emphasizes outdoor activities, healthy living, and community engagement, making it ideal for both young professionals and families.

Are there any community events or local gatherings throughout the year?

Yes, Grande residents can participate in several community events hosted in Davis throughout the year. Popular events include the Davis Farmers Market held weekly in Central Park, as well as the annual Davis Arts Festival and Picnic Day at UC Davis, which brings the whole community together for music, food, and cultural activities. Additionally, local neighborhood associations often organize block parties and seasonal gatherings to foster a strong community spirit.

What types of homes are common?

Grande primarily features modern single-family homes with contemporary designs, ranging from townhouses to spacious detached houses. Many homes incorporate eco-friendly features, reflecting Davis's commitment to sustainability. The neighborhood architecture blends Craftsman and California contemporary styles, with well-maintained yards and tree-lined streets contributing to the area's charm.
